Output 63c3404abd8614c599eddaf98f60a5ea619b9ac0da960e580d8f8d58aebcc8a7:17

value
76533
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40e86af2691bd1070a0db32c3e2a6a994e50f741d486da1508d6e123197977bb
address
bc1pgr5x4unfr0gswzsdkvkru2n2n989pa6p6jrd59gg6msjxxtew7asmxxz9z
transaction
63c3404abd8614c599eddaf98f60a5ea619b9ac0da960e580d8f8d58aebcc8a7
spent
true